Why Agile Methodologies Are Valuable in Renewable Energy

Renewable energy projects often involve multiple phases such as planning, environmental assessment, infrastructure development, and system deployment. Each phase requires coordination between different teams and stakeholders.

Traditional project management approaches may rely heavily on rigid planning structures, which can limit flexibility when unexpected changes occur. Agile methodologies provide a more adaptive approach that allows teams to adjust strategies while maintaining clear project goals.

Common challenges in renewable energy projects include:

  • Coordinating multidisciplinary engineering and development teams
  • Managing evolving regulatory and environmental requirements
  • Aligning project stakeholders and investors
  • Maintaining progress across long infrastructure development timelines
  • Adapting to technological advancements in clean energy systems

Agile practices help teams address these challenges by promoting transparency, collaboration, and continuous feedback.

How Agile Training Supports Renewable Energy Professionals

Agile training introduces practical tools and frameworks that help professionals manage projects in a flexible and collaborative way. For renewable energy leaders, these approaches support better coordination between technical teams and project stakeholders.

Key skills developed through Agile training include:

Iterative Project Planning

Agile encourages breaking large projects into smaller, manageable phases. This approach allows teams to review progress regularly and make adjustments as needed.

Cross-Team Collaboration

Renewable energy projects involve engineers, project managers, environmental specialists, and financial analysts. Agile frameworks promote communication and collaboration across these teams.

Continuous Improvement

Agile methodologies encourage teams to regularly evaluate project progress and refine processes to improve efficiency.

Faster Decision-Making

Agile practices enable quicker responses to technical challenges and project changes by promoting regular communication and feedback loops.

Stakeholder Engagement

Renewable energy initiatives often involve regulators, investors, and community stakeholders. Agile frameworks help teams maintain strong engagement throughout the project lifecycle.
